Sympathy And System In Giving is a book written by Elwood Street and published in 1921. The book explores the concept of giving and how it can be done in a way that is both sympathetic and systematic. Street argues that giving should not be done impulsively or haphazardly, but rather with a clear plan and purpose. He also emphasizes the importance of empathy and understanding the needs of those who are receiving the gifts. The book provides practical advice and examples of how to give effectively and efficiently, while also maintaining a sense of compassion and empathy.
